Downtown Willoughby Rib Burn Off
Kicking off the summer events in downtown Willoughby on May 21st and 22nd is the Downtown Willoughby Rib Burn Off. In its fifth year, this event has become downtown Willoughby’s largest event, and one of Northeast Ohio’s largest free music festivals. Last year the event grew immensely with the addition of on an extra day a main stage that had country superstar Frankie Ballard. This year Uncle Kracker is headlining the event on Saturday Night. While you are in attendance, get your fill of ribs from nearly 20 different local and national rib vendors. Plus, there are 3 stages with musical entertainment in front of Arabica, Frank and Tony’s and Burgers n Beer. For more information visit the Downtown Willoughby Rib Burn Off website.
Classic Car Cruise In
The Classic Car Cruise In is a favorite in Willoughby and Lake County. On Saturday June 18th, the event kicks off at 4:00 pm and closes at 11:00 pm that evening. Erie Street, Euclid Ave, Wes Point Park, and City Hall Parking Lot will be filled with hundreds of cars from different eras. A car lover’s dream! There will be live music on the main stage, and of course all your favorite local restaurants will be ready to satisfy your hunger. Come spend the day at one of Ohio largest classic cruise ins.
Willoughby ArtsFest
In its 25th year the Willoughby ArtsFest has grown exponentially to become one of the best arts festivals in Ohio. There are over 130 juried artists with mediums ranging from paintings, to jewelry, and wood carvings. The event takes place on Saturday. July 18th, from 10:00 am to 5:00 pm spanning throughout all of Historic Downtown Willoughby. This year be sure to check out the wine tent and Kids Studio located in Citizen’s Bank front lawn. The wine tent will feature some of Ohio’s favorite wineries including Debonne, Ferrante, and Grand River Cellars. If the kids are coming with along, the Kid’s Studio will give you a place to take the kiddos for some fun and activities. Musical entertainment will be provided in the Gazebo in Wes Point Park, as well as street musicians performing throughout the event. Check out the ArtsFest Website for more information!
Last Stop Willoughby
Last Stop Willoughby is a time honored event. On August 20th starting at 12:00 pm the entire day of festivities kicks off! Musical entertainment, the Kid Zone, trolley tours and The Taste of Willoughby kick the event off. At 2:00 pm the parade comes down Euclid Avenue into the heart of Downtown Willoughby. After the parade Jeep lovers can migrate to the Willoughby Brewing Company and Sol parking lot for the Jeepalooza where over one hundred jeeps will be parked. After the parade this year the Heart Award Winner will be announced. For more information visit the website.
Pig and Whiskey
Pig and Whiskey is the newest of all the events in Downtown Willoughby. In its third year the event has grown year after year to be a huge success. Held in Willoughby Brewing Company parking lot, this August 26th-28th is sure to be packed. Last year the headliners for Saturday and Sunday night were Vertical Horizon and Smashmouth. This year the headliners for 2016 are Eve 6, Tropidelic, and Brother Trouble. Local favorites Post Road, The Spazmatics, Susie Oravec, and many others will performing throughout the weekend. There won’t be any shortage of wonderful barbecue from 14 national and local vendors. Visit the website for more information.
